Job Summary and Responsibilities

Acentra Health is looking for a Utilization Manager (Emergency Medicine) to join our growing team.

Job Summary:

  • The purpose of this position is to utilize clinical expertise to review medical records against appropriate criteria in conjunction with contract requirements.

Responsibilities:

  • Review and interpret patient records to determine medical necessity and appropriateness of care; determines if medical record documentation supports the need for services.
  • Quickly assess data and information accurately for diagnoses and appropriate treatment recommendations
  • Review hospital notes to identify life or limb-threatening diagnoses - including records from emergency and critical care services, oncology services, and dialysis services.
  • Review requests from doctors for prescriptions and associated diagnoses
  • Foster positive and professional relationships and act as liaison with internal and external customers to ensure effective working relationships and team building to facilitate the review process.
  • Responsible for attending training and scheduled meetings and for maintenance and use of current/updated information for review.
  • Maintain medical records confidentiality at all times through proper use of computer passwords, maintenance of secured files, adherence to HIPAA polices.
  • Utilize proper telephone etiquette and judicious use of other verbal and written communications, following Acentra Health policies, procedures and guidelines
  • Actively cross-train to perform duties of other contracts within the Acentra Health network to provide a flexible workforce to meet client/consumer needs.
  • Read, understand, and adhere to all corporate policies including policies related to HIPAA and its Privacy and Security Rules.

Qualifications

Required Qualifications

  • Bachelor's Degree from an accredited college or university
  • Minimum 5 years nursing experience
  • Eligible to obtain MN RN license; a compact license is not acceptable in MN
  • Medical record abstracting skills required.
  • Knowledge of medical terminology and disease process required.
  • Strong clinical assessment and critical thinking skills
  • Knowledgeable of CPT/HCPC codes
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ills required.
  • Ability to work in a team environment.
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ced environment and make decisions quickly and confidently
  • Flexibility and strong organizational skills needed.
  • Must be proficient in Microsoft Office and internet/web navigation.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Knowledge of current URAC standards strongly preferred.
